Journal of Law and Economics

Website for the Journal of Law and Economics (ISSN 0022-2186) published twice a year by the University of Chicago. The journal was established in 1958, and aims to explore the complex relationships between law and economics, focusing on the influence of regulation and legal institutions on the operation of economic systems. Although topically varied, articles are most often concerned with how markets behave and with the actual effects of governmental institutions on markets, providing a basis for an informed discussion of public policy.

Researching the Harmonization of International Commercial Law

Online guide to the harmonization of international commercial law written by Loren Turner who is the Foreign, Comparative, and International Law Librarian at the University of Minnesota Law School. The guide was published in 2005 (and updated in 2022) on the Globalex website and made freely available by the Hauser Global Law School Program at the New York University School of Law. It provides an introduction to the subject and to the types of instruments of harmonization.

UNILEX

UNILEX is a browsable database produced by the International Institute for the Unification of Private Law (UNIDROIT). It contains case law and bibliographies relating to the UN Convention on Contracts for the International Sale of Goods (CISG) and the UNIDROIT Principles of International Commercial Contracts. The text of each instrument is provided, along with a list of participating countries. The cases are arranged by date, country, arbitral award and by article and issues.

England and Wales High Court (Commercial Court) Decisions

A BAILII database containing decisions of the Commercial Court of the High Court of England and Wales. The database contains all decisions made publicly available through the Courts service from 1999 onwards to date. Cases are listed alphabetically by party name and chronologically by year, with a comprehensive search facility and separate listing of Recent Cases. The British and Irish Legal Information Institute (BAILII) is a collaborative service working to provide free access to primary legal materials for the United Kingdom and Republic of Ireland.
